Date & Origin
England, c1730. Period of George II.
Condition
Excellent, age-related wear as shown.
Dimensions
Height: 22.9cm Rim diameter: 11cm Foot diameter: 10.6cm.
Weight
534 grams
Technical Description
An 18th century Baluster stem goblet. A large round funnel bowl rests upon a baluster stem featuring a teared inverted baluster knop, cushion knop, teared inverted baluster and a basal knop. The piece is supported by a conical foot with a rough pontil.
